Abstract: | A steam-vacuum sanitizer reduced aerobic plate counts associated with bovine faecal contamination from 5.5 log10 cfu cm?2 to 3.0 ± 0.21 log10 cfu cm?2 on beef carcass short plates. The same beef carcass short plates inoculated wiht 7.6 ± 0.09 log10 cfu cm?2 Escherichia coli O157: H7 in faeces, yielded an average residual level of E. coli O157: H7 of 2.1 ± 0.21 log10 cfu cm?2 after steam-vacuum treatments. This study demonstrates the effectiveness of a steam-vacuum sanitizer for removing E. coli O157: H7 from beef carcasses. |
